为什么需要清除浏览器缓存才能正常访问HTTP?
301重定向是一种永久重定向,浏览器会将这种重定向信息缓存起来,以便下次访问相同URL时直接跳转到目标URL,而不需要再次请求服务器。因此,即使你在服务器端取消了301重定向规则,浏览器仍然会根据缓存的重定向信息直接跳转到HTTPS页面。为了确保能够正常访问HTTP页面,需要清除浏览器的缓存。具体方法如下:
-
强制刷新页面:
- 在浏览器中,使用
Ctrl + Shift + R组合键强制刷新页面。这会强制浏览器重新请求服务器,而不是从缓存中读取数据。
- 在浏览器中,使用
-
手动清除浏览器缓存:
- 打开浏览器的设置或开发者工具,找到清除缓存的选项。不同浏览器的操作方法略有不同,但通常都可以在设置或开发者工具中找到。
- 例如,在Chrome浏览器中,可以按
F12打开开发者工具,选择“Application”选项卡,找到“Clear storage”部分,点击“Clear site data”按钮,清除缓存和Cookies。

扫码添加技术【解决问题】
专注企业网站建设、网站安全16年。
承接:企业网站建设、网站修改、网站改版、BUG修复、问题处理、二次开发、PSD转HTML、网站被黑、网站漏洞修复等。
专业解决各种疑难杂症,您有任何网站问题都可联系我们技术人员。
本文来自博客园,作者:黄文Rex,转载请注明原文链接:https://www.cnblogs.com/hwrex/p/18583105

浙公网安备 33010602011771号